During your surgery and rehabilitation, you'll work closely with a healthcare team that can include the following people:
An Orthopaedic Surgeon will perform your knee replacement
surgery and monitor your recovery.
Nurses will prep you before surgery, care for you after
surgery, and help you manage post-operative pain.
A Physical Therapist (PT) will help you strengthen the
muscles around your prosthetic hip, teach you exercises that will help increase
your range of motion, and show you how to get in and out of bed correctly.
An Occupational Therapist (OT) will teach you how to
safely perform common daily activities.
A Case Manager will discuss hospital discharge plans
with you.
